Magnum Estate Presented Indonesia at the Forum in Davos

Magnum Estate represented Indonesia at the largest economic event — the Davos Forum.

The annual forum was attended by about 60 heads of state, as well as representatives of the global elite from more than 120 countries. The total number of participants exceeded 2,800.

The main theme of the forum was “Restoring Trust”: participants discussed how to ensure security and organize cooperation “in a fractured world”.

A wide range of issues was addressed at the forum: from the global economy and finance to artificial intelligence and investments in developing countries, including Indonesia.

Magnum Estate participated in a panel discussion on foreign investments.

The company presented a detailed report on the investment attractiveness of Bali and its prospects, as well as showcased its projects that will soon transform the island into a prime destination for premium tourism.

In addition to building resort properties, Magnum Estate, together with the Indonesian authorities, is actively developing infrastructure in the most popular areas of Bali.

This synergy is already yielding initial results. After the event, investors from various countries became even more interested in Indonesia and expressed a desire to invest millions of dollars in the country’s economy, including in resort and commercial real estate in Bali.
